Mastercard wants to move stablecoins, not issue them

Payments giant Mastercard is eyeing the stablecoin market — but its plans don’t include issuing cryptocurrency.  Instead, Mastercard aims to develop the rails on which stablecoins will function, Raj Dhamodharan, executive vice president for blockchain and digital assets, told Bank Automation News. “We see our role in [stablecoins] as we look at what we do […]
